Jobs program is helping Wilcox County’s adolescence achieve actual international


CAMDEN, Alabama — Benjamin Lightner spends a excellent little bit of his summer season getting younger Wilcox County employees able for and busy in the actual international.

As government director of Wilcox Works, a Camden, Alabama, nonprofit that works to attach the folks of Wilcox County with employment alternatives, Lightner and his staff function a summer season adolescence employment program (SYEP).

Established in 2017 and carried out each summer season since, SYEP is basically for more youthful citizens of Wilcox County, ages 15-21, in the hunt for seasonal or transient paintings that might result in full- or part-time positions.

This system teaches individuals find out how to get a task, what onboarding looks as if, and is helping to instill in them holistic values that almost all employers respect.
